Output 343a434aa14ec7a95b82dfd7bb5e7cb104071775cd020e853df5cdd63ca3806e:0
- value
- 19634793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8615d25b7f5fd64dcc727bfbc60372d78d56b1f1 OP_EQUAL
- address
- 3DuzcSw5dq4uc8NH62nk3JRqYVfUdwMvF1
- transaction
- 343a434aa14ec7a95b82dfd7bb5e7cb104071775cd020e853df5cdd63ca3806e
- confirmations
- 4250
- spent
- true